This book compiles historical notes and a review of the work of the author and his associates on shock compression of condensed matter (SCCM). The work includes such topics as foundational aspects of SCCM, thermodynamics, thermodynamics of defects, and plasticity as they relate to shock compression, shock-induced phase transition, and shock compaction. Also included are synthesis of refractory and hard ceramic compounds such as Ni aluminides, SiC and diamonds, method of characteristics, discrete element methods, the shock compression process at the grain scale, and modeling shock-to-detonation transition in high explosives. The book tells the story of how the author’s view of shock physics came to be where it is now. and analytically discusses how the author’s appreciation of shock waves has evolved in time. It offers a personal but pedagogical perspective on SCCM for young scientists and engineers who are starting their careers in the field. In the United States, about 60 percent of men and 50 percent of women experience, witness, or are affected by a traumatic event in their lifetimes. Many of them (8 percent of men and 20 percent of women) may develop post-traumatic stress disorder (PTSD)--a life-altering anxiety disorder. Once connected mainly with veterans of war, PTSD is now being diagnosed in many situations that cause extreme trauma such as rape, physical attacks or abuse, accidents, terrorist incidents, or natural disasters. The millions of family members of those who have PTSD also suffer, not knowing how to help their loved one recover from the pain. Shock Waves is a practical, user-friendly guide for those who love someone suffering from this often debilitating anxiety disorder, whether that person is a survivor of war or of another harrowing situation or event. Through her own experience, extensive research, advice from mental health professionals, and interviews with those working through PTSD and their families, Cynthia Orange shows readers how to identify what PTSD symptoms look like in real life, respond to substance abuse and other co-occurring disorders, manage their reactions to a loved one's violence and rage, find effective professional help, and prevent their children from experiencing secondary trauma. Each section of Shock Waves includes questions and exercises to help readers incorporate the book's lessons into their daily lives and interactions with their traumatized loved ones.

This book introduces the core concepts of the shock wave physics of condensed matter, taking a continuum mechanics approach to examine liquids and isotropic solids. The text primarily focuses on one-dimensional uniaxial compression in order to show the key features of condensed matter’s response to shock wave loading. The first four chapters are specifically designed to quickly familiarize physical scientists and engineers with how shock waves interact with other shock waves or material boundaries, as well as to allow readers to better understand shock wave literature, use basic data analysis techniques, and design simple 1-D shock wave experiments. This is achieved by first presenting the steady one-dimensional strain conservation laws using shock wave impedance matching, which insures conservation of mass, momentum and energy. Here, the initial emphasis is on the meaning of shock wave and mass velocities in a laboratory coordinate system. An overview of basic experimental techniques for measuring pressure, shock velocity, mass velocity, compression and internal energy of steady 1-D shock waves is then presented. In the second part of the book, more advanced topics are progressively introduced: thermodynamic surfaces are used to describe equilibrium flow behavior, first-order Maxwell solid models are used to describe time-dependent flow behavior, descriptions of detonation shock waves in ideal and non-ideal explosives are provided, and lastly, a select group of current issues in shock wave physics are discussed in the final chapter.

You're young, in love, and in paradise ... surfing, traveling, partying. Then in one terrifying wave of heat and noise your reality shatters into a million pieces that can never be put back together. On October 12, 2002, a massive car bomb ripped through the popular Kuta nightclub, the Sari Club, killing 202 people and maiming many others. Hanabeth Luke was hamming it up on the dance floor to cheesy pop tunes with a friend when a loud bang, like a car back-firing, momentarily silenced the music and dimmed the lights. Dancers stopped and heads turned, but the music and flashing lights soon came back on and the party resumed. But only for a few seconds ... "The noise which came next I will never forget. It was an empty sound that did not resonate. It was a thud, like the slam of a car door, but multiplied to a volume I simply cannot describe," Hanabeth writes in this extraordinary memoir. Hanabeth survived the Bali Bomb, somehow crawling through the flaming wreckage and using fallen electrical cables to shimmy over a four metre high concrete wall. But her boyfriend Marc Gajardo was killed instantly in the blast. The heart-wrenching story of young love, and lives, cut short is chilling and confronting, . Her raw and honest account of those dreadful events brings the spectre of terrorism into sharp and intensely personal focus. Yet it is the story of what Hanabeth has done since which brings a spark of hope and light to this awful chapter in our history. Confronting world leaders, campaigning for peace and against the war on terror, raising money and awareness, resolving to squeeze the most from every day, Hanabeth's inspirational tale provides a stirring case study in survival and healing.

Shock wave-boundary-layer interaction (SBLI) is a fundamental phenomenon in gas dynamics that is observed in many practical situations, ranging from transonic aircraft wings to hypersonic vehicles and engines. SBLIs have the potential to pose serious problems in a flowfield; hence they often prove to be a critical - or even design limiting - issue for many aerospace applications. This is the first book devoted solely to a comprehensive, state-of-the-art explanation of this phenomenon. It includes a description of the basic fluid mechanics of SBLIs plus contributions from leading international experts who share their insight into their physics and the impact they have in practical flow situations. This book is for practitioners and graduate students in aerodynamics who wish to familiarize themselves with all aspects of SBLI flows. It is a valuable resource for specialists because it compiles experimental, computational and theoretical knowledge in one place.
